1C31234G01provides48VDCon-cardauxiliarypowerfor16contactinputswithcommonreturn.
9.3SPECIFICATIONSELECTRONICSMODULE(1C31234)
Table9-2describesthespecificationsoftheCompactContactInputmodule.
Table9-2.CompactContactInputModuleSpecifications
Description
Value
Numberofchannels
16
Onboardauxiliarypowersupply
42Vminimum55Vmaximum
Propagationdelay
7mSecmaximum
ContactbouncerejectionAlwaysrejectscontactchangeofstateAlwaysacceptscontactchangeofstate
<3mSec>7mSec
Closedcontactoutputcurrent
4mAminimum8mAmaximum
Diagnostics
InternalmoduleoperatingfaultsGroundFaultDetection
Dielectricisolation:
Channeltologic
1000VAC/DC
Modulepower
4.56Wtypical4.75Wmaximum
Operatingtemperaturerange
0to60qC(32qFto140qF)

7,AI卡(4-20mA输入)1C31224G01/1C31227G01
DCS对现场供电(供电)
注:
P(N)和CI(N),SH(N)和地(E)需短接

供电AI信号屏蔽线在DCS侧接地,现场侧悬空。

备注:
外供电的AI信号,分屏线接C2、C4……C16,分屏蔽线在现场端要接地。

16.LC卡(串口通讯卡)1C31166G01/1C31169G02
两线:
A15与B15、A16与B16、B14与B15短接。
信号线:
B15----接正端
B16----接负端
四线:
A14与A15、B14与B15短接
信号线:
A15----接接收正端
A16----接接收负端
B15----接发送正端
B16----接发送负端
屏蔽线都是系统侧接地则接C17、系统外接地则接C16。
